Added Value Poem by Octavian Cocos

Added Value



Two sparkling diamonds and a ruby lie
On her beloved hand, so soft and white,
Today, he looks at them with a cold eye
Although the people marvel at their sight.

Two sparkling diamonds and a ruby cut
With greatest skill, as for a mighty king
And smoothed with love and carefulness somewhat
To fit exactly on a golden ring.

Two sparkling diamonds and a ruby are
Like her red mouth and big eyes, there's no doubt,
Which seem to cry and suffer from afar
For a sweet love that suddenly died out.

Two sparkling diamonds and a ruby now
Have added value and they will prevail
Because they surely make an honest vow,
To glitter, but to also tell a tale.
